The Tire problem

15" cooper lifeliner GLS tires of various ages from new to 2 years old are cracking on the inside edge near the rim. We have approximately 38 tires showing this condition. We have purchsed new tires from another company as replacements.   Read details...

The Tire Sidewall problem

We experienced a sidewall blowout of a bridgestone turanza el42 (21565r16 98t) on our 2003 Dodge Caravan (only 20,800mi) when I drove to the home. When I check other tires. I found a same problem on another tire --- few cracks on the sidewall.   Read details...

The Tire Blowout problem

2003 grand Caravan tire blew out. The consumer stated the cruise control was set and all of a sudden, she felt the vehicle swerve to the right and hit the guardrail.   Read details...
